What is the value of x
olchik [2.2K]
The two angles shown form a linear pair.
The angles are supplementary, which means their measures add to 180 deg.
Now we can write an equation and solve for x.

5x + 120 = 180

5x = 60

x = 12

Answer: x = 12

Make r the subject p(r-s) = 2r<br><br>PLEASE HELP ME GUYSSS
Makovka662 [10]

Answer:

p(r-s) = 2r

pr - ps = 2r

pr - 2r = ps

r(p-2) = ps

r = \frac{ps}{p  - 2}
